Brief information about the Cell Expansion

One of the main challenges of using cell expansion in drug discovery is the need to maintain the cells in a state that accurately reflects their behavior in vivo. Cells grown in culture may behave differently than those in their natural environment, leading to false positives or negatives in drug screening assays. To address this issue, researchers are developing new techniques to create more realistic "organoid" models, which mimic the structure and function of tissues in vivo more closely.


Moreover, the expansion of heterogeneous cell populations can result in variable responses and functions, which can limit the reproducibility and reliability of cell-based assays or therapies. Lastly, the scalability of cell production is critical for the translation of cell-based therapies from the lab to the clinic, as it requires the development of cost-effective and efficient manufacturing processes.


In conclusion, the science of cell expansion has made remarkable progress in recent years, with numerous advancements in culture systems, growth factors, and cell therapy applications. These advancements have opened up new opportunities for the development of more effective and personalized therapies, as well as the understanding of fundamental biological processes. However, the challenges that the field faces, such as ensuring cell quality, controlling heterogeneity, and scaling up production, must be addressed to fully realize the potential of cell-based therapies and technologies.


Despite its many applications, cell expansion is not without its limitations. One of the main challenges is the cost and complexity of the process. Growing large populations of cells in culture can be time-consuming and resource-intensive, requiring specialized equipment and trained personnel. In addition, the quality of the cells produced can vary widely depending on a variety of factors, including the source of the cells, the culture conditions, and the methods used for expansion.
